Top Categories of Cat Stocking Stuffers

Not sure where to begin? Here are some top categories to consider for stocking stuffers that will surely delight your feline friend.

1. Toys That Stimulate and Engage

Cats love to play. Engaging toys can keep them occupied for hours. Think about interactive toys that require them to move around, like laser pointers or feather wands. I’ve watched Milo chase a laser dot as if it were a real mouse, priceless.

2. Treats and Snacks for Feline Indulgence

Who doesn’t love a tasty treat? Gourmet cat treats are perfect for stuffing into their stockings. Look for options that are grain-free or packed with protein. My cat goes nuts for tuna-flavored treats. Did you know that about 40% of cats prefer fish-based snacks? (Source: Pet Food Industry)

3. Practical Cat Accessories

When considering stocking stuffers, practical gifts can be a sweet surprise. How about a cozy cat bed or a new food dish? I recently upgraded Milo’s water bowl to one that keeps the water fresh and flowing, and he loves it.

4. Health and Grooming Products

Spoil your kitty with health and grooming items. A nice brush can help keep their fur shiny and reduce shedding. You might even toss in some dental treats to keep their pearly whites clean. I’ve noticed that regular grooming helps Milo’s coat stay fluffy and beautiful.

Creative Ideas for Personalizing Cat Stocking Stuffers

Adding a personal touch can make your gifts extra special. Here are some fun ideas:

  • Custom Toys: You can order toys shaped like a favorite character or even a photo of your cat stitched onto a pillow. Milo has a plush toy that looks just like him.
  • Monogrammed Accessories: Consider a personalized collar with your cat’s name. It’s not just cute: it also helps in case they ever get lost.
  • Homemade Treats: Love baking? I often whip up cat-friendly cookies using recipes online. It’s a fun way for me to bond with Milo, and he loves the tasty results.

Budget-Friendly Cat Stocking Stuffer Options

Stocking stuffers don’t have to be expensive. Here are some great budget-friendly options that your cat will love:

  • DIY Toys: Create fun toys from everyday items. Balls of yarn, crumpled paper, or even empty boxes can provide hours of entertainment.
  • Bulk Treats: Buy treats in bulk for significant savings. Many pet stores offer discounts for larger quantities, allowing you to fill their stocking without emptying your wallet.
  • Grooming Brushes: You can find affordable grooming brushes that help keep your kitty’s fur healthy. I bought a great one for under $10, and it works wonders on Milo’s coat.
